Transaction 10882e4d6f3a924c055f43d34cdf05e1e66c8fcaea349cf4c319f74be4566002

1 Input
2 Outputs
  • 10882e4d6f3a924c055f43d34cdf05e1e66c8fcaea349cf4c319f74be4566002:0
  • value  7793047896
    address  3FMMWbqBnpZZnmqNUicgoJQajMRY4VQQPv
  • 10882e4d6f3a924c055f43d34cdf05e1e66c8fcaea349cf4c319f74be4566002:1
  • value  4000000
    address  1NUxVdp5ZXrWz6NbEtDrr61k4T9LcKddMu